Yanceyville, North Carolina is a small town located in Caswell County with a population of just over 2,000 residents. It is known for its charming downtown area and historic buildings, as well as its close proximity to natural attractions such as the Mayo River State Park. However, like many small towns, Yanceyville also has its own unique set of pros and cons that contribute to the overall experience of living there.
